Like CactusPUGHIO/IOHDF5, CarpetIOHDF5 now also provides parallel I/O for
data and checkpointing/recovery.
The I/O mode is set via IOUtils' parameters IO::out_mode and IO::out_unchunked,
with parallel output to chunked files (one per processor) being the default.
The recovery and filereader interface can read any type of CarpetIOHDF5 data
files transparently - regardless of how it was created (serial/parallel,
or on a different number of processors).
See the updated thorn documentation for details.

* better general error checking and reporting
- check return code of HDF5 API calls
- replace asserts with CCTK_VWarns of level 0 or 1 where appropriate
- don't just assert (0) if no valid checkpoint file was found
* allow relaxed recovery mode (don't stop, only warn about variables which
don't exist at recovery time)
* MPI optimizations: gather lots of individual MPI_Bcasts into a single one
for each datatype
Tested with CarpetIOHDF5's checkpointing/recovery testsuite.
In case of problems, it should be easy to roll back to the previous state:
the old code is still there in iohdf5chckpt_recover.cc.
Things left to do:
* merge recovery and filereader code
* review of checkpointing code
* rename I/O parameters
* reduce the set of attributes to a minimum
